What is the hormone, brain, & weight connection? Do you look at your waist and see a pooch - a muffin top - that seemed to come out of nowhere? Unexplained weight gain? The infamous “spare tire?” And every diet you have tried will not cause the weight to budge?


What has happened? There are 3 likely possibilities:


Estrogen Dominance:

  • causes you to store almost everything you eat as fat

  • causes water weight and salt retention

Insulin resistance:

  • intake of too much sugar & too many carbs have caused your body to stop releasing insulin properly because it does not want to put this sugar in your cells

  • your brain is then signaled to make more insulin to try to rectify the situation

  • this insulin release causes you to have constant hunger even though you are storing fat

High stress:

  • cortisol receptor sites, in addition to estrogen receptors, also exist around the midsection

  • stress raises cortisol levels

  • now you are on the "cortisol merry-go-round" and you store more fat

What about dieting? Will it help? If you restrict calories, your body adjusts accordingly & slows metabolism. Therefore, this is not your answer. Restricting your calories significantly will then make you feel more miserable because you are not eating enough.


Brain chemistry is KEY. Your brain needs specific nutrients- if it doesn’t get them, it sends out a hunger signal – that signal says, "EAT!" What often happens is that you OVEReat.
